United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is seeking Grounds Maintenance Operatives in Flackwell Heath. Responsibilities include grass cutting, hedge trimming, and litter control using powered tools.
The role requires candidates to have a clear criminal record and a valid driver's license, with at least 3 years of experience preferable.
The positions are permanent after a successful probation period of 13 to 15 weeks, with working hours from 7.30am to 5pm, Monday to Friday. Pay rate is up to £15.07 per hour.
